Abstract
The invention discloses an intelligent control working station. The intelligent control working station comprises security protection equipment, wherein a working station main body is connected to the security protection equipment; supporting legs, a touch screen and a box door are arranged on the working station main body; anti-explosion electronic locks are arranged on the box door and the working station main body; an intelligent control unit, a working unit, a UPS unit and a self protection device which are connected with the touch screen are arranged inside the working station main body; the UPS unit is connected with the intelligent control unit and the self protection device; a through hole which allows a line to pass is formed in the lower end surface of the working station main body. According to the intelligent control working station, a control system and a using mode thereof, which are provided by the invention, the influence on a security protection system caused by power failure is avoided; meanwhile, relevant equipment is prevented from being destroyed by a person with an ulterior motive, the operation safety of an enterprise is well guaranteed, and the accidental loss of the enterprise is avoided.

Background technology
The development and incorporation of computer technology and the communication technology, makes the intellectuality of safe precaution measure reach its maturity, and intelligent safety and defence system obtains during the nearly last ten years and develops fast, but also there are some problems.Specification is more late for Time Created, and the product of equipment supplier is powered at equipment, all there is certain difference in interface shape, signal kinds, agreement, dimensions of mechanical structures, mounting means etc., is in particular in:
(1) equipment is powered aspect: by direct current, exchange way, the voltage standard also disunity that direct current mode is powered;
(2) interface shape: data acquisition end is basically identical, Main Differences is the diversity of the transmission after Data Collection;
(3) signal kinds: the difference having differential signal, asymmetrical signals;
(4) communication mode and agreement aspect: have RS232, RS485, Wei root bus, Ethernet;
(5) physical construction aspect: size dimension is different, mounting means is different;
Because these above-mentioned difference exists, to the design of safety-protection system, construction, use, administer and maintain band and serve inconvenience, in the installation environment of equipment, line arrangement is loaded down with trivial details, device layout unsightly, field management and plant maintenance chaotic.In the process used, if run into the situation had a power failure suddenly, safety-protection system will face the awkward situation of paralysis, still can the blank of security protection for some time even if carry out follow-up power supply, brings great potential safety hazard to enterprise; Power supply and cabling mode are easy to be learnt by people, and simultaneously unique people is also easy to destroy relevant circuit, thus allow people have time can to bore, and this often brings immeasurable loss to enterprise.

Embodiment 2
The managing and control system be made up of intelligent management and control workstation, described managing and control system comprises center main control system, and the intelligent management and control workstation that at least one Tai Yugai center main control system is connected.This center main control system is connected with intelligent management and control workstation by cable network or wireless network.
Related data when running feeds back on the main control system of center by intelligence management and control workstation, and relevant staff is exercised supervision by the ruuning situation of center main control system to each intelligent management and control workstation, and is operated on it and control by remote control.The related personnel of intelligence management and control workstation also comes to carry out remote communication with the related personnel of operation center's main control system by camera, microphone and loudspeaker.Just related personnel can be immediately sent to carry out maintenance and repair to it when center main control system finds that certain intelligent management and control workstation runs and goes wrong.Internal staff cannot directly operate intelligent management and control workstation, thus well avoids internal staff and destroy it, substantially increases security.
